Skip to content

É uma interface de dicionario animado criado com ReactJS junto a um ambiente Docker. Todo seu conteudo exibido é gerado por via de scraping ao website dicio.com.br.

Notifications You must be signed in to change notification settings

thecodergus/dicionario

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

43 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Dicionario

O que é?

É uma interface de dicionario animado criado com ReactJS junto a um ambiente Docker. Todo seu conteudo exibido é gerado por via de scraping ao website dicio.com.br.

O que ele faz?

  • Faz scrap das palavras pesquisadas diretamente de dicio.com.br
  • Exibe as pesquisas em tela de forma animada

O que compõe o Projeto?

  1. TypeScript
  2. ReactJS
  3. Ant Design
  4. axios
  5. React Router
  6. yarn
  7. Framer
  8. Docker
  9. Docker Compose

Arvore de diretorios e arquivos do projeto

👉(Clique aqui 🔥)👈
.
├── README.md
├── builds
│   └── nodejs.Dockerfile
├── docker-compose.yml
└── src
    ├── README.md
    ├── package.json
    ├── public
    │   ├── favicon.ico
    │   ├── index.html
    │   ├── logo192.png
    │   ├── logo512.png
    │   ├── manifest.json
    │   └── robots.txt
    ├── src
    │   ├── components
    │   │   ├── App.tsx
    │   │   ├── BarraPesquisa.tsx
    │   │   ├── Conteudo
    │   │   │   ├── Classe.tsx
    │   │   │   ├── Etimologia.tsx
    │   │   │   ├── Item.tsx
    │   │   │   ├── Palavra.tsx
    │   │   │   ├── Significados.tsx
    │   │   │   ├── Sinonimos.tsx
    │   │   │   └── index.tsx
    │   │   ├── Home.tsx
    │   │   └── home.css
    │   ├── index.css
    │   ├── index.tsx
    │   ├── reportWebVitals.ts
    │   ├── services
    │   │   ├── requests.ts
    │   │   └── utils.ts
    │   └── types
    │       └── index.ts
    ├── tsconfig.json
    ├── yarn-error.log
    └── yarn.lock

Como instalar?

  • Com Docker e projeto buildado
  1. git clone https://github.com/gusscamargo/dicionario
  2. cd dicionario
  3. docker-compose build
  4. docker-compose up -d
  5. Espere carregar
  6. Acesse 127.0.0.1
  • Sem Docker e projeto não buildado
  1. git clone https://github.com/gusscamargo/dicionario
  2. cd dicionario/src
  3. npm install ou yarn install
  4. npm start ou yarn start
  5. Espere carregar a compilação
  6. Acesse 127.0.0.1:3000

Como usar:

  1. Digite a palavra e aperte enter ou clique no botão.
  2. Espere.

GIF

About

É uma interface de dicionario animado criado com ReactJS junto a um ambiente Docker. Todo seu conteudo exibido é gerado por via de scraping ao website dicio.com.br.

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published